KNOCK KNOCK KNOCK~

A knock came at the door. Outside was a familiar voice. Huang Jiutian recognized it as one of the construction workers from his company.

"Huang Gong, I brought you lunch!"

The door opened immediately, and a young man walked in carrying a lunch tray with meat, vegetables, and a bowl of soup.

He placed the tray on the table, then looked excitedly and curiously at Huang Jiutian, who was sitting listlessly on the bed.

"Xiaodu, are there any rumors about me out there? I don’t think I’ll be able to work for a while. Is the company going to send a new designer to the site?"

Huang Jiutian asked, his voice muffled and dejected.

"Huang Gong! You’re my idol now!!"

At this, Xiaodu glanced cautiously at the doorway, took a few steps closer to Huang Jiutian, and whispered.

"Even though there’s a gag order, all of us stationed here know. You’re amazing!!"

Huang Jiutian’s interest was piqued.

"How am I amazing? What are the rumors?"

"Lu Gong said you’re actually a high-level secret agent working for the government, and Zhang Gong said you might be someone from something like the ’Dragon Team’!!! And what was that thing they were making such a fuss to hunt down before? Oh, right, um, Huang Gong, I have a patriotic heart, too..."

"You in there, don’t disturb Mr. Huang’s rest. He has things to do tonight."

A voice cut off Xiaodu’s heartfelt confession.

There were clearly guards outside, but to avoid making Huang Jiutian uncomfortable, they were standing out of sight from within the room.

"You should go. We can talk more next time I’m back at the company."

Huang Jiutian said with a smile, sending Xiaodu on his way.

The young man was clearly reluctant to let this opportunity go.

"Uh, Huang Gong, now that your identity is exposed, can you even come back to our company? But if you ever need help, just say the word and I’ll be there!"

The young man left with a smile, but Huang Jiutian’s expression turned troubled.

’That’s right, can I even go back to the company? And how am I supposed to tell Little Hero about this...?’

But Jiutian wasn’t too worried about "Dawn" being exposed prematurely.

At first, he had been terrified, afraid his own exposure would affect Qin Xiaoxia and the association’s plans. But during their two-hour conversation, Jiutian gradually realized something.

It seemed these people had misunderstood something. Well, not exactly a misunderstanding. If he were in their shoes, he would definitely think along the same lines—seeing himself as a Superpower User who had awakened some Ability amidst a changing world, or perhaps a newly evolved human.

Based on this judgment, Jiutian subtly guided his interrogators’ line of thought during the question-and-answer session.

For example, his nonchalance when he first awakened, his shock upon discovering it, and his recent nervousness and fear.

’But I hadn’t expected the rumors outside to paint me as a government agent. Or perhaps... was it a deliberate move by that Leader Tao?’

As for academic questions like where the bug monsters came from, when they arrived, whether there were any left, and why they hadn’t acted sooner—he’d let someone else get a headache over those.

...

「Meanwhile, in Kyoto」

In an unremarkable office, a white-haired old man was writing something on a document on his desk while listening to his secretary’s report.

"Huang Jiutian, male, 29 years old, Han ethnicity, a native of Qingzhen, Yue City, Zhejiang Province. Political affiliation: civilian. Unmarried. Good relationships with family and friends. No physical illnesses, no mental illnesses, no bad habits..."

...

"He is currently suspected of being a newly evolved human with Extraordinary Perception and Visual Sense, as well as partial physical enhancement. According to Leader Tao’s assessment, individuals with this type of Perception will be of strategic-level importance, both now and in the future."

Although Tao Xingzhi’s detailed report on the incident hadn’t been submitted yet, the information on Huang Jiutian himself had already been uploaded immediately.

Jiutian wasn’t some undocumented person; his file was pulled up in a matter of seconds.

After hearing the report, the old man took off his glasses, put down his pen, and a faint smile appeared on his face.

"It seems Xiaotao really is our lucky star."

...

「As evening approached」

Huang Jiutian had an early dinner, then walked to the construction site’s parking lot with Tao Xingzhi and Xiaoliu, protected by several plainclothes personnel.

Li Donglai was already waiting there.

Today, the construction site’s top leader completely changed Huang Jiutian’s impression of him, to the point where it felt like his very concept of a "leader" was being overturned.

He took a step forward, shaking hands with Tao Xingzhi and Xiaoliu one by one, before shaking hands with Huang Jiutian.

His grip was powerful, heavy.

"Youths are just so full of vigor! Huang Gong, if we have the chance to work together again in the future, we can consider ourselves old friends who’ve been through thick and thin together, haha!"

Huang Jiutian repeatedly said he was unworthy of the praise and bid him farewell with a smile.

They had several business vans, but their interiors were unlike those of ordinary ones. One of them was exquisitely furnished inside, and the driver’s cabin was partitioned off from the back.

Once in the car, Tao Xingzhi, who had been stone-faced the whole time, finally broke into a smile.

"This Li Donglai... he’s no simple character."

Xiaoliu took three cans of cola from the car’s mini-fridge, handing one to Tao Xingzhi and another to Huang Jiutian.

"Tao, what are you saying? Is anyone who reaches a high position ever simple?"

"True! Look at me, I’m not simple at all, right? Ha!"

A burst of laughter filled the car, and even Jiutian’s tension began to ease with the relaxed atmosphere.

The van first circled the construction site a few times, then began spiraling outwards in wider and wider arcs with the site as the center.

During this time, at Tao Xingzhi’s request, Huang Jiutian extended his "Perception."

They circled continuously, weaving in and out of Jia City, but after two or three hours, Huang Jiutian still hadn’t sensed anything.

Only then did Tao Xingzhi mutter, "Let’s hope it really was just those few," and had the driver head for the airport.

There was simply too much to do; they couldn’t have Huang Jiutian stay behind and act as a "Radar" for long-term observation.

Tao Xingzhi’s mood was light, however, or at least much lighter than it had been recently, when he felt the weight of the world on his shoulders.

The background check on Huang Jiutian had already begun. So far, everything looked good. Barring any surprises, the young man was certain to become a member of his team.

He knew that many big shots who had received the news were interested in Huang Jiutian, but setting aside the fact that he was the first to discover him and that they had faced a common enemy...

Who could compete with him? Who would dare try to snatch the man from him now? Who would dare try to steal resources from the hands of the crucial "Tenth Man"!

Right up until he boarded the plane, Huang Jiutian didn’t even have a chance to send a text or make a call home. His family probably still thought he was on-site at his job.

Two private jets were parked at the airport.

As Jiutian got out of the car, he could see a ramp had been set up to one of the jets, and large crates were being pushed up it one by one.

Judging not only by their size, but also by the faint fluctuation of Magic Power that reappeared on his arm, those must be the corpses of the bug monsters.

"Let’s go, Huang Gong. Thank you for your cooperation. You can rest assured—I, Tao Xingzhi, give you my personal guarantee that you will not lose your freedom!"

Tao Xingzhi understood the former designer’s worries. It was rare for someone in this situation to be as calm and rational as Huang Jiutian, who had been remarkably cooperative the entire time.

What could Huang Jiutian say at a time like this?

He could only follow them onto the other plane.
